Temperature abuse for ice cream happens when it’s not stored at the proper cold temperature, usually around 0°F (-18°C). This causes ice crystals to grow larger, making the ice cream grainy and icy. Fluctuations or warming can also melt and refreeze it, damaging flavor and texture. How Fluctuating Temperatures Damage Ice Cream’s Texture and Flavor

temperature fluctuations cause ice crystal growth

When ice cream is subjected to fluctuating temperatures, its texture and flavor suffer noticeably. Temperature swings cause ice crystals to grow larger, disrupting the smooth ice cream consistency you expect. This growth results in a grainy, icy mouthfeel that diminishes enjoyment. Additionally, inconsistent temperatures compromise flavor preservation, as exposed surfaces undergo melting and refreezing cycles that weaken taste stability. These cycles also lead to ice crystal growth, which further impacts texture and flavor. Over time, the flavor becomes muted or develops off-notes, making your favorite treat less appealing. These fluctuations also cause fat separation and ice crystal growth, further altering texture and making ice cream less creamy. To maintain peak quality, it’s essential to keep ice cream consistently frozen, preventing temperature swings that damage its smoothness, richness, and overall flavor integrity. Easy Tips for Storing Ice Cream to Prevent Temperature Problems

store ice cream properly

Proper storage is key to maintaining ice cream’s safety and quality after it’s purchased. To prevent temperature problems that cause flavor degradation and texture changes, keep your ice cream consistently cold. Store it in the coldest part of your freezer, away from door openings, which expose it to temperature fluctuations. Guarantee the container is airtight to avoid freezer burn and odors. Use a sturdy, sealed container instead of the original carton to prevent air exposure.

Tip Why it matters
Keep at constant temperature Prevents flavor loss and ice crystal formation
Store away from door Avoids temperature swings
Use airtight containers Maintains texture and flavor integrity

Common Storage Mistakes That Lead to Freezer Burn and Melting

proper freezer temperature and packaging

If your freezer isn’t set to the right temperature, your ice cream can quickly develop freezer burn or start melting. Opening the door frequently causes temperature fluctuations that compromise its quality. Using inadequate packaging also exposes your ice cream to air and moisture, making it easier to spoil.

Improper Freezer Temperature Settings

When freezer temperatures are set too high, ice cream becomes vulnerable to freezer burn and melting. This improper freezer temperature setting can cause ice crystals to form unevenly, affecting the ice cream flavor and texture. If your freezer isn’t calibrated correctly, it may not maintain a consistent temperature, leading to spoilage. Always keep your freezer at around 0°F (-18°C) to preserve quality. Failing to do so allows warmer air to cause partial melting and refreezing, which damages the ice cream’s smoothness. Regularly check and calibrate your freezer to ensure it stays at the right temperature. Proper calibration prevents temperature fluctuations that can compromise your ice cream’s flavor and texture, keeping it fresh and enjoyable for longer.

Frequent Opening Causes Melting

Frequent opening of the freezer introduces warm air, which can cause your ice cream to melt and refreeze repeatedly. This cycle disrupts the ice cream’s consistency, making it icy or grainy instead of smooth. Each time the freezer door opens, it raises the internal temperature and forces the ice crystals to melt. When the freezer cools down again, the melted ice cream refreezes, creating a rough texture. To prevent this, practice good freezer maintenance by limiting how often you open the door and keeping it closed as much as possible. Proper storage habits help maintain a stable temperature, preserving the ice cream’s quality and preventing unwanted melting. Remember, consistency in your freezer’s environment is key to enjoying smooth, creamy ice cream every time.

Inadequate Packaging for Storage

Inadequate packaging is a common mistake that can lead to freezer burn and melting of your ice cream. When packaging isn’t secure, it compromises packaging integrity, allowing air and moisture to reach the ice cream. Seal failure is a major culprit, often caused by damaged or poorly sealed containers. If the seal isn’t airtight, ice crystals form, resulting in freezer burn and a loss of texture and flavor. Always check that your containers are properly sealed before storing your ice cream. Using airtight, sturdy packaging helps maintain the correct temperature and prevents exposure to external air.
